La Salle wins bronze as 2026 PWL closes

Three-time champion De La Salle University closed the 2026 PFF Women’s League (PWL) season by winning the bronze medal with seven points following a 1-1 draw against the University of the Philippines (UP) on Saturday at the Adidas Football Park, SM Mall of Asia in Pasay City.

An equalizer by Chenny Dañoso from an outside shot to close the first half secured the podium finish for the Lady Booters, as the Fighting Maroons finally won a point with an early goal by Patricia Espinosa from a set piece in the fourth minute.

“To close the season with such a competitive game is a testament of the character of the Filipina footballer: that feisty, palaban spirit that brought us to back-to-back Women’s World Cup, and that spirit is being kindled here in PWL,” said PFF John Anthony Gutierrez.

Dañoso, who finished her season fifth in scoring with four goals, praised her teammates who “stepped up” following the absence of three key La Sallians–starting goalkeeper Jessica Pido, midfielder Maegan Alforque, and forward Dani Tanjangco–who were lined up by PWL champion Kaya FC-Iloilo for the 2026-27 AFC Women’s Champions League (AWCL) preliminary round in Bishkek, Kyrgyzstan.

Kaya won their third consecutive PWL crown on August 11, amassing 21 points, while the Far Eastern University (FEU) Lady Tamaraws won the silver medal with 12 points.

Kaya has advanced to the AWCL group stage this November by topping the preliminary round Group B on Sunday while FEU, La Salle, and UP will compete in the upcoming UAAP Season 89, which will open on September 12.
